Port Blair: Naval ships have sprung into action to transport hundreds of passengers stranded at Port Blair and Hut Bay due to 'adverse' weather condition.

Officials of the Andaman and Nicobar Command said 372 passengers stranded at Hut Bay were transported by naval ships to Port Blair in the early hours of on Sunday.


The ANC had deployed three ships for this.


Yesterday 439 passengers stranded at Port Blair were transported to Hut Bay.


Officials said the naval ships were pressed into service because the normal shipping services between Port Blair and Hut Bay remained suspended on May 21 and 22 due to 'adverse' weather condition, resulting in a large number of passengers being stranded at both ends.
